If your association is considering offering a career center as a member benefit, you want to make sure it’s easily accessible and user-friendly.

After all, you want to keep your members happy, right? We’ve all experienced the hassle and frustration that can come along with the login process of any website. Between lost username and password information and the overwhelming storage of that data by companies, sometimes logging into a site can ruin the experience altogether.

But this is where a Single Sign On feature for your association's job board can solve a lot of your problems. With Single Sign On, your association can allow its job board users to have a seamless sign on experience with the job board software, saving them the frustration of creating and remembering all new usernames and passwords- and overall, getting right to the job board without a hassle.
